How has a reduction in economic regulation contributed to the increased importance of logistics?

In the United States, the reuctions in economic regulation allowed individual carriers flexibility in pricing and service. The flexibility is very important to logistics for several reasons and it first provided companies with the ability to implement the tailored logistics approach in the sense that companies could specify different logistics services levels and prices could be adjusted accordingly.
